SUMMARY

Q2 is seeking a Senior FinOps Lead to build and drive our cloud financial management practice from the ground up. As the first dedicated hire in this function, you will have the mandate to define the strategy, select the tooling, and build the culture of cost accountability across our engineering organization.

You will act as the bridge between Finance, Engineering, and Procurement, translating complex AWS & Azure data into actionable business value. You won’t just “report” on costs; you will drive architectural efficiency and empower our engineers to make cost-aware decisions. This is a high-impact, founding role for someone who wants to write the playbook rather than just follow it.

R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Develop forecasting models and financial reporting for cloud spend.

  • Design and manage commitment strategies such as Reserved Instances and Savings Plans.

  • Lead cross-functional optimization initiatives with engineering teams.

  • Establish tagging standards and cost allocation frameworks.

  • Develop executive dashboards and reporting on cloud cost trends and risks.

  • Support vendor negotiations and long-term infrastructure planning.


EXPERIENCE AND KNOWLEDGE:

  • Typically requires a Bachelor’s degree in (relevant degree) and a minimum of 12 years of related experience in FP&A, financial analysis, FinOps, or infrastructure cost analysis; or an advanced degree with 8+ years of experience; or equivalent related work experience

  • Proven track record in establishing and maturing a FinOps practice, implementing governance, cost-allocation models, show back/chargeback, and optimization programs

  • Deep knowledge of public-cloud pricing and billing models (AWS, Azure) and demonstrate success in optimizing committed spend, reserved instances, and savings plans

  • Demonstrated ability to partner cross-functionally with Engineering, Finance, Procurement, and Product Management to align financial outcomes with technical priorities

  • Proven ability to lead automation and tooling initiatives that increase cost visibility, tagging accuracy, and real-time spend governance

  • Experience in high-growth SaaS or multi-tenant environments with measurable improvements in cost efficiency and financial predictability

  • Experience developing and presenting executive-level reporting and insights to senior leadership and boards, including trend analysis, variance, and risk projections

  • Strong written and verbal communication skills

  • Strong financial modeling and forecasting capabilities, connecting cloud spend to unit economics and business metrics

  • Solid understanding of FP&A, forecasting, and variance analysis

  • Familiarity with infrastructure, automation, and cloud architecture as they relate to performance and cost

  • Demonstrated operational discipline in building scalable processes

  • Awareness of emerging cloud financial technologies, such as AI-driven anomaly detection, predictive spend models, and sustainability metrics
